Mumbai police have forwarded a proposal for extradition of jailed gangster Lawrence Bishnoi's younger brother Anmol Bishnoi, who has been named as an accused in some high-profile crimes, including the Baba Siddique murder case, an official said. The proposal was sent after the US authorities informed the Mumbai police about Anmol Bishnoi's presence in their country, the senior police official said on Saturday. Last month, the Mumbai police's crime branch moved the special Maharashtra Control of Organised Crime Act (MCOCA) court here stating that it intends to «initiate the extradition procedure of fugitive criminal Anmol Bishnoi».

Congress is facing a significant reduction in its presence in Mumbai for the upcoming assembly elections, contesting only 11 seats compared to 30 in 2019. This is the party’s smallest seat share in years. After extensive discussions with Shiv Sena (UBT), led by Mumbai Congress President MP Varsha Gaikwad and MLA Aslam Shaikh, the party struggled to secure a better deal under the MVA alliance. Observers point out that many of the seats they are competing for are strongholds of the BJP, where Congress is unlikely to succeed.

Mumbai: Samvat 2081 kicked off on a firm note as the country’s stock benchmarks gained nearly half a percent in Friday’s 60-minute Muhurat trading session, marking the start of the Hindu New Year. The Sensex closed at 79,724, up 335 points or 0.42%, after advancing as much as 634 points. The Nifty ended 94 points or 0.39% higher to close at 24,299.55. The Nifty Midcap100 index rose 0.67% while the Nifty Smallcap 100 went up 0.87%. Of the 3,648 traded stocks on the BSE, 3,017 advanced, while 558 declined.

Bandra East was a Shiv Sena stronghold until the last Maharashtra assembly elections, but with a triangular contest this time, the outcome in this suburban Mumbai seat has become more unpredictable. Zeeshan Siddique, then with Congress, won from the constituency in 2019, defeating the undivided Shiv Sena's Vishwanath Mahadeshwar, a former mayor. Zeeshan might have an edge due to the sympathy factor in the aftermath of his father, NCP leader and former Congress minister Baba Siddique's murder earlier this month. But locals also say that his decision to join the Ajit Pawar-led Nationalist Congress Party, an ally of the BJP, could go against him as the constituency has a sizable Muslim population. The Ajit Pawar-led NCP is part of the ruling BJP-Shiv Sena-NCP 'Mahayuti' alliance.

Bandra West assembly seat, comprising an area with plush houses of some of Bollywood's top film stars as well as localities from Santacruz and Khar, was a Congress stronghold till 2014 before the BJP wrested it through its city unit chief and high-profile leader Ashish Shelar. Shelar, seeking a third win on the trot, is pitted against the Congress' Asif Zakaria, who was defeated by the former in 2019 by a margin of 26,507 votes. Bandra West assembly seat has 2,87,657 voters, comprising 1,49,443 men and 1,38,204 women. It has some of the poshest houses in the city, mainly in Bandra West and Khar, as well as teeming slum colonies apart from middle class localities of Santacruz. The area sees a steady stream of visitors all through the year as people from across the country arrive to catch a glimpse of film icons Shah Rukh Khan and Salman Khan.

property market, has scaled a new peak by recording the best October performance in terms of registration of real estate deals and revenue collection through stamp duty charges. The festive period, beginning with Navratri followed by Diwali, are considered auspicious for property purchases, and has played a key role in this rise in registrations apart from the ongoing positive momentum in deal activity. The country’s commercial capital has registered 12,915 property transactions during the month, up 22% from a year ago, while the exchequer has fetched 44% higher revenue worth Rs 1,201 crore through stamp duty collections, showed data from inspector general of registration, Maharashtra.

Housing society management app Mygate saw its operating revenue rise 35% to Rs 96 crore in the financial year ended March 31 from Rs 71 crore in 2022-23. The Bengaluru-based company's consolidated net loss narrowed significantly by 82% to Rs 40 crore from Rs 227 crore a year ago. This sharp cut in losses was driven by a 51% reduction in its total expenses, which came down to Rs 149 crore in 2023-24 from Rs 304 crore in the previous year. In 2023-24, the company spent Rs 82 crore on employee benefits while incurring other expenses of Rs 61 crore.
